Your SMPS idea should work fine. Probably want to use a different (bigger) connector than an XLR for the currents involved, but that’s minor. Also want to have the smps on a common switch so they turn on and off at the same time.

A 200va dual 18 or 20v transformer (not 28) will be great for a single channel. 280va would run a stereo amp.
